专家系统与人工神经网络在铜管拉拔工艺中的应用 被引量:4

Application of Expert System and Artificial Neural Network to Drawing Process of Copper Tube

摘要 本文详细论述了专家系统与人工神经网络相结合(ANNES)在铜管拉拔工艺设计中的应用。它以专家系统为数据处理工作台,以管坯和成品管的外径、壁厚为输入,以拉拔道次和各道次外径、壁厚为输出,利用神经网络完成推理和知识库的维护。文中以实例说明了 SNNES 的实用性,计算结果与实际值的差别小于5%。 The paper expounds in detail the application of Expert System combined with Artificial Neural Network(ANNES)to the drawing process design of copper tubes.The ANNES takes the ES as a data processing platform,the diameter and wall thickness of the tube shell and finished tube as its input,the drawing passes and the diameter and wall thickness of each pass as its output,and uses the ANN to carry out reasoning and maintenance of the intellectual base.The paper illustrates the practicality of ANNES with examples,in which the difference between calculation results of ANNES and actual results is less than five percent.
